The Langham Huntington
The Langham Huntington is a large hotel on sprawling grounds in Pasadena, featuring classical architecture and manicured gardens throughout the property. Inside, high ceilings, polished wood finishes, and tall windows create elegant spaces filled with natural light.
The hotel opened its doors in 1907 and has welcomed guests for over a century in Pasadena. It has maintained its classical style while becoming part of the city's social fabric, hosting weddings, events, and community gatherings through the decades.
The hotel reflects the refined tastes of early 20th century Pasadena through its design and furnishings. Walking through its spaces, you encounter pieces and details that connect to the city's long tradition of welcoming travelers and hosting community events.
The hotel is conveniently located in Pasadena near attractions such as the Rose Bowl and the California Institute of Technology. The grounds offer walking paths through gardens, and several restaurants inside provide dining options without leaving the property.
The property features a large pool surrounded by trees, creating a sense of privacy, and an on-site spa offering massage and skincare treatments. These amenities allow guests to relax without leaving the grounds.
